Great American entered the Surety market 100 years ago, bringing a history of strong performance, secure resources and a broad appetite for business opportunity to this important industry segment.
Agents and customers rely on the expert underwriting, solid financial strength, market leadership and personal service they receive from the Bond Division. With a highly diverse product line that includes both Commercial and Contract solutions, the division is one of the leading surety companies in the United States with loss results that are well below the industry average.
While the Division continues to be one of the largest writers of Contract bonding, they are also a leading provider of Commercial Surety bonds with an emphasis on Miscellaneous, License & Permit, Court, Fiduciary and Public Official bonds.

Based in Cincinnati, Ohio, the operations of Great American Insurance Group are engaged primarily in property and casualty insurance, focusing on specialty commercial products for businesses. We have more than 30 specialty property and casualty insurance businesses, and in 2021, approximately 50% of our gross written premium in our property and casualty operations was generated by business units with a Top 10 market ranking. Great American Insurance Company has received an "A" (Excellent) or higher rating from the AM Best Company for more than 110 years (most recent rating evaluation of "A+" (Superior) affirmed December 3, 2021). The members of Great American Insurance Group are subsidiaries of American Financial Group, Inc. (AFG), also based in Cincinnati, Ohio.
